2 lssx0817 lssx0817 于 2016.02.08 20:43 提问

C语言Easyx的一个问题,请大神帮忙看看

不知道为什么不出东西。。
struct img
{
int x;
int y;
IMAGE imggrass;
struct img next;
};
main()
{
struct img *p;
p=(struct img
)malloc(sizeof(struct img));
initgraph(640,480);
loadimage(&p->imggrass, "res\bmp_grass.bmp");
p->x=50;
p->y=50;
putimage(p->x,p->y,&p->imggrass);
getch();
closegraph();
}

1个回答

caozhy
caozhy   Ds   Rxr 2016.02.08 21:25

IMAGE imggrass;
修改为
IMAGE * imggrass;

loadimage(&p->imggrass, "res\bmp_grass.bmp");
换上完整路径看看

lssx0817
lssx0817 不行啊。。。
接近 2 年之前 回复
Csdn user default icon
上传中...
上传图片
插入图片
准确详细的回答,更有利于被提问者采纳,从而获得C币。复制、灌水、广告等回答会被删除,是时候展现真正的技术了!